Man who tried to join ‘terror group’ outside Canada makes court appearance in Brampton, RCMP says

A man arrested after allegedly trying to leave Canada to join a terrorist group has made his first court appearance in Brampton, the RCMP says.

Few details about the case have been released, but Mounties say a 32-year-old man was placed on a terrorism peace bond on Saturday.

The man was arrested by the RCMP’s Integrated National Security Enforcement Team and made a court appearance in Brampton on Sunday, Mounties say.

Police have not said where the man was arrested or what “terror group” he allegedly tried to join.

The matter is under a publication ban, including the name of the accused and evidence in the case.
